Understanding the Origins of Bravo Zulu

The term "Bravo Zulu" originates from the NATO phonetic alphabet, where "Bravo" represents the letter "B" and "Zulu" represents the letter "Z." When combined, "Bravo Zulu" spells out "BZ," which stands for "Well Done." This phrase is used to acknowledge a job well done, often in situations where clear and concise communication is crucial. The use of the NATO phonetic alphabet ensures that messages are understood accurately, even in noisy or chaotic environments.

The Historical Context of Bravo Zulu

The historical context of "Bravo Zulu" is deeply rooted in naval and military traditions. The phrase was commonly used in the United States Navy to convey praise and recognition for a task well executed. Over time, its usage has expanded beyond the military, becoming a part of everyday language in various professional and personal settings. The simplicity and clarity of "Bravo Zulu" make it an effective way to convey appreciation and acknowledgment.
